The Customer Loyalty Ladder is a framework that can be used to analyze the customer journey and identify the opportunities for increasing customer loyalty. It is a strategic tool for marketers to better understand the needs of their customers, and how they can meet these needs.
The Customer Loyalty Ladder framework consists of five stages: Awareness, Consideration, Conversion, Retention and Advocacy. The first four stages are concerned with customer acquisition while the last stage is focused on retaining customers who have already made a purchase. It is important for businesses to have an in-depth understanding of this framework in order to effectively design marketing strategies and campaigns that will encourage their customers to buy more products and services from them.
